TKG icon indicating copy to clipboard operation
TKG copied to clipboard

TEST TARGETS SUMMARY does not capture failed test and resulted false positive test build

Open llxia opened this issue 9 months ago • 5 comments

runtime-api-java_security_0 failed but is not in TEST TARGETS SUMMARY. The test build finished in SUCCESS, which is a false positive.

related: internal issue

08:09:01  Test results: passed: 448; failed: 1
...
08:09:02  runtime-api-java_security_0_FAILED
10:08:39  TEST TARGETS SUMMARY
10:08:39  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
10:08:39  DISABLED test targets:
10:08:39  	compiler-api-javax_tools_0
10:08:39  	runtime-api-java_util-regex_0
10:08:39  
10:08:39  PASSED test targets:
10:08:39  	compiler-api-signaturetest_0 - Test results: passed: 2 
10:08:39  	runtime-api-java_lang-instrument_0 - Test results: passed: 10 
10:08:39  	runtime-api-java_lang-invoke_0 - Test results: passed: 110 
10:08:39  	runtime-api-java_lang-reflect_0 - Test results: passed: 143 
10:08:39  	runtime-api-java_lang-Package_0 - Test results: passed: 12 
10:08:39  	runtime-api-java_lang-String_0 - Test results: passed: 64 
10:08:39  	runtime-api-java_lang-StringBuilder_0 - Test results: passed: 25 
10:08:39  	runtime-api-java_lang-StringBuffer_0 - Test results: passed: 28 
10:08:39  	runtime-api-java_lang-ClassLoader_0 - Test results: passed: 35 
10:08:39  	runtime-api-java_lang-ModuleLayer_0 - Test results: passed: 23 
10:08:39  	runtime-api-java_lang-module_0 - Test results: passed: 163 
10:08:39  	runtime-api-java_lang-StackWalker_0 - Test results: passed: 8 
10:08:39  	runtime-api-java_lang-Module_class_0 - Test results: passed: 42 
10:08:39  	runtime-api-java_lang-SecurityManager_0 - Test results: passed: 2 
10:08:39  	runtime-api-java_lang-System_0 - Test results: passed: 26 
10:08:39  	runtime-api-java_lang-Class_0 - Test results: passed: 83 
10:08:39  	runtime-api-signaturetest_0 - Test results: passed: 20 
10:08:39  	runtime-api-modulegraph_0 - Test results: passed: 1 
10:08:39  	runtime-api-javax_naming-spi_0 - Test results: passed: 129 
10:08:39  
10:08:39  TOTAL: 21   EXECUTED: 19   PASSED: 19   FAILED: 0   DISABLED: 2   SKIPPED: 0
10:08:39  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
10:08:39  
10:08:39  TESTCASES RESULTS SUMMARY: passed: 32,585; failed: 1; error: 0; skipped: 0
10:08:39  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
10:08:39  ALL TESTS PASSED
...
Finished: SUCCESS

llxia avatar Mar 11 '25 13:03 llxia

Is this related or similar https://github.com/adoptium/aqa-tests/issues/4092?

sophia-guo avatar Mar 11 '25 14:03 sophia-guo

The above build has ITERATIONS=1. I do not think it is related to https://github.com/adoptium/aqa-tests/issues/4092

llxia avatar Mar 11 '25 15:03 llxia

We have also just recently seen a case of this.

Preliminary questions, has the Jenkins plugin been updated on servers recently and if so, what changes did it have, has there been a regression in it?

smlambert avatar Mar 12 '25 14:03 smlambert

Noticed another case on zlinux (link)

07:22:20.715  TEST TARGETS SUMMARY
07:22:20.715  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
07:22:20.715  PASSED test targets:
07:22:20.715  	MachineInfo_0
07:22:20.715  	MachineInfo_0
07:22:20.715  	MachineInfo_0
07:22:20.715  	MachineInfo_0
07:22:20.715  	MachineInfo_0
07:22:20.715  	MachineInfo_0
07:22:20.715  	MachineInfo_0
07:22:20.715  	MachineInfo_0
07:22:20.715  	MachineInfo_0
07:22:20.715  
07:22:20.715  TOTAL: 9   EXECUTED: 9   PASSED: 9   FAILED: 0   DISABLED: 0   SKIPPED: 0
07:22:20.715  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++

Only MachineInfo_0 in the summary. None of the other tests are tracked in TEST TARGETS SUMMARY.

07:22:20.001  -----------------------------------
07:22:20.001  ParallelStreamsLoadTest_special_J9_27_PASSED
07:22:20.001  -----------------------------------

llxia avatar May 01 '25 21:05 llxia

Another case. In the console output, we ran TESTLIST=openJcePlusTests_0,cmdLineTester_vmRuntimeState_0,testDDRExt_Callsites_0,testSCCMLTests6_0,testSCCMLTests5_1,cmdLineTester_jvmtitests_extended_nongold_6,cmdLineTester_jvmtitests_extended_nongold_1,testSCCMLTests6_1,testDDRExt_Class_0,threadMXBeanTestSuite1_0,TestAttachErrorHandling_0,cmdLineTester_dumpromclasstests_0,testSCCMLTests2_0, but TKG only printed openJcePlusTests_0

link

[2025-07-12T19:48:21.018Z] TEST TARGETS SUMMARY
[2025-07-12T19:48:21.018Z] 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
[2025-07-12T19:48:21.018Z] FAILED test targets:
[2025-07-12T19:48:21.018Z] 	openJcePlusTests_0
[2025-07-12T19:48:21.018Z] 
[2025-07-12T19:48:21.018Z] TOTAL: 1   EXECUTED: 1   PASSED: 0   FAILED: 1   DISABLED: 0   SKIPPED: 0
[2025-07-12T19:48:21.018Z] 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++

internal issue

llxia avatar Jul 15 '25 19:07 llxia